What are uterine fibroids and should I be concerned?
Uterine fibroids are very common, non-cancerous growths in the uterus. They are often asymptomatic, but can sometimes cause heavy bleeding or pain. Dr. Grabois can help monitor them and discuss treatment options if they become problematic.

What's the difference between perimenopause and menopause?
Perimenopause is the transitional period leading up to menopause, often characterized by irregular periods and early symptoms. Menopause is the point when periods have stopped for 12 consecutive months. Dr. Grabois provides guidance and support through both stages.
How do I perform a breast self-exam, and how often should I do it?
The goal of a breast self-exam is breast self-awareness—knowing what's normal for your body. Perform a self-exam monthly to recognize any changes, such as new lumps or skin changes. It's important to remember that this is a supplement to, not a replacement for, clinical exams by Dr. Grabois and mammograms.
